Lawsuit claims probation wrongly extended based on ability to pay restitution
A new lawsuit filed in federal court on Thursday challenges a state law that allows judges to extend probation beyond an established ceiling if someone is unable to pay restitution. The lawsuit, brought by the American Civil Liberties Union of Kansas on behalf of four plaintiffs, was lodged against Attorney General Kris Kobach as well as six current and former Johnson County judges.
